About Christina Rossetti
Christina Rossetti, the Victorian era English poet, is known for the melancholy themes in such poems as "Goblin Market" and "When I Am Dead." She was born in 1830 in London to Italian-born parents. Her father was poet Gabriele Rossetti and her brother was the painter/poet Dante Gabriel Rossetti. She rejected two marriage proposals because, although she loved both men, neither shared her religious devotion. According to her brother, she wrote effortlessly and rapidly. She died in 1894.
